HISTORY OF THE DERBY READY FOR SOUVENIR BOOK LOUISVILLE, Ky., April 3. The complete, official history of the Kentucky Derby will be an outstanding feature of this years edition of the Souvenir Derby Book. The book, edited by Daniel E. OSullivan, resident manager of Churchill Downs, was published for the first time last year. AH research in connection with the history of Americas greatest race was done by OSullivan. As the official memento of the occasion the book, published by Churchill Downs, is distributed at the track on Derby day, when each patron receives a copy with the compliments of the management. Of this years supply of 75,000, copies will be mailed to sporting editors of some 200 or more newspapers published in North America,
